Ingredients
4
Ready-made puff pastry (about 230g)1 sheet
Apples (about 400g)3 medium
Sugar50 g
Raisins40 g
Pine nuts30 g
Ground cinnamon1 teaspoon
Breadcrumbs20 g
Egg1
Melted butter20 g
Instructions
1
Peel and slice the apples.
2
In a bowl, mix the sliced apples with sugar, raisins, pine nuts, and cinnamon. Let it rest for a few minutes.
3
Roll out the puff pastry on a lightly floured surface.
4
Sprinkle breadcrumbs over the puff pastry to prevent it from becoming soggy.
5
Spread the apple mixture over the breadcrumbs.
6
Gently roll the puff pastry with the filling inside, sealing the edges well.
7
Brush the surface of the strudel with melted butter and beaten egg.
8
Bake in a preheated oven at 350°F (180°C) for about 35 minutes, until the strudel is golden and crispy.
9
Let it cool slightly before slicing and serving.
